Tribute from Masako Nozawa, who played Tetsuro Hoshino in GE999:

"Maetel, when I heard the news of your passing, tears welled up and I couldn't stop them. Since we co-starred in Galaxy Express 999, we always called each other "Tetsuro-chan" and "Maetel" even when we weren't recording, and we were often looked at with surprised faces by the people around us in coffee shops. To me, Maetel is not "Ikeda-san," "Masako-san," or "Mako-chan," but Maetel herself. She was a beautiful, dignified, and lovely comrade with a wonderful smile. With Matsumoto-sensei and the conductor gone on their journeys, Maetel was the only friend left, but now even Maetel has left this world, and I feel terribly lonely. But I'm sure Maetel boarded the 999 and went on a journey with the conductor and Matsumoto-sensei. Just like in the movie, I've been left behind here, but I'll do my best here for a while longer until we meet again on some other planet. I'm looking forward to that time.

Voice actress Masako Ikeda passed away on March 3rd due to a cerebral hemorrhage. She was 87 years old. The Tokyo Actors' Cooperative Association announced her death today. The wake and funeral were held privately with only close relatives in attendance, in accordance with the wishes of her family.

She is most known for the roles of Reika "Madame Butterfly" Ryuuzaki in Aim for the Ace!, Maetel in Galaxy Express 999, Nodoka Saotome in Ranma ½, Michiko in Harmagedon, and for being the Japanese voice-over actress of Audrey Hepburn.
